Transaction 435855df064c521b23be48e0fa93af326f5d1d9623840b42c5143ecb7159f7a8
1 Input
1 Output
-
435855df064c521b23be48e0fa93af326f5d1d9623840b42c5143ecb7159f7a8:0
- value
- 2067794
- script pubkey
- OP_0 OP_PUSHBYTES_20 73f27bb1b1edb400366448c65a60bf593c54da93
- address
- bc1qw0e8hvd3ak6qqdnyfrr95c9lty79fk5nz2uunj